Why not a stopgap solution for 6 months? |
|
Forget the $700 billion. Allow only temporary emergency measures to be implemented right now. This would prevent the lame ducks from ramming through some self-serving comprehensive bailout terms for which they can't be held accountable once they leave office. It would also give Congress time to research the whole mess, gain input from multiple economists, and explore comprehensive solutions.
Is there any legitimate reason to believe this all has to be done right now by the lame duck Bush administration?
